Evansville Police rescued two elderly residents from a burning house. WNIN’s John Gibson has details:
It happened at about 1:30 Friday morning at 515 S. Grand Ave.
The Evansville Fire Department says police responded to a burglar alarm at the home and when officers arrived, they found flames coming from the roof.
EFD Division Chief Mike Larson says the officers entered the home and removed two elderly occupants.
One occupant was transported to St. Vincent’s Hospital for a non-fire, non-life-threatening injury.
Larson said when firefighters arrived, they traced the fire to an attic space above a bathroom.
Crews extinguished the blaze in about 15 minutes and electric service had to be disconnected.
The occupants were displaced and the Red Cross was notified.
The investigator classified it as an accidental electrical fire.
There was no word of any firefighter injuries.
